#e86618 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e86618 is composed of 91% red, 40%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 22.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#e86618 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c30 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#e86618 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e86618 has RGB values of R:232, G:102,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.9,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15230488.

Shades and Tints of #e86618
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f4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#e86618
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867e7a is the less saturated color, while #fc6104 is the most saturated one.
